Fostering Innovation Through Clear Communication
The connection between effective communication and the innovation pipeline is profound. When technical leaders prioritize communication skills, employees feel empowered to share creative solutions that may lead to new business opportunities. For instance, the author's own journey revealed that attending public speaking workshops, like Toastmasters, dramatically increased his ability to pitch new projects to leadership, thereby enhancing the chance of turning ideas into actionable initiatives. For MedSpas, equipping team members with the skills to present innovative treatments or operational efficiencies can establish a competitive edge.
